Block

#18,872,442
Block Number
18,872,442 @ 06/19/2024, 24:12:30
Status
Finalized
ID
0x011ff87aa4883a274e73bd66e6f9dbece6efa39ad7f8941771a45d0e49ff11ae
Transactions
Gas Used
105164/40000000 (0.26% Used)
Total Score
158,764,831 (+14)
Rewards
0.63 VTHO